win10app开发操作流程介绍

Win10 App开发是指在Windows 10操作系统上开发应用程序的过程。Win10 App开发提如何把网页封装成exe供了丰富的API和工具,使开发者能够轻松地创建各种类型的应用程序,如桌面应用程序、通用Windows平台应用程序、Xbox One应用程序等。本文将介绍Win10 App开发的原理和详细过程。

一、Win10 App开发的原理

Win10 App开发基于Windows通用平台(UWP)。Windows通用平台是Microsoft推出的一种应用程序开发平台,旨在帮助开发者创建适用于所有Windows 10设备的应用程序。这意味着,开发者只需编写一次代码,就可以在PC、平板电脑、手机、Xbox One等各种设备上运行。

Windows通用平台提供了一套共享的API和工具,包括XAML、C#、C++和JavaScript等语言,使开发者能够在不同设备上构建统一的用户体验。此外,Windows通用平台还提供了一种称为“自适应布局”的技exe生成服务术,可以根据设备的屏幕大小和分辨率自动调整应用程序的布局。

二、Win10 App开发的详细过程

Win10 App开发的过程包括以下步骤:

1. 安装开发工具

首先,需要安装Visual Studio 2017或Visual Studio 2019等最新版本的开发工具。这些工具提供了UWP应用程序开发所需的所有组件和工具。

2. 创建项目

在Visual Studio中创建新项目时,选择“通用Windows平台”模板。这样可以创建一个适用于所有Windows 10设备的应用程序。

3. 设计用户界面

使用XAML标记语言和Visual Studio中的界面设计器来设计应用程序的用户界面。XAML是一种基于XML的标记语言,用于描述应用程序的用户界面。

4. 编写代码

使用C#、C++或JavaScript等语言编写应用程序的代码。在Windows通用平台中,可以使用任何一种语言进行开发。开发者可以使用Visual Studio的调试工具来调试应用程序。

5. 测试和发布

在开发完成后,可以在不同的设备上进行测试。一旦测试通过,可以将应用程序发布到Windows商店中,使用户能够下载和使用。

总结

Win10 App开发是一种基于Windows通用平台的应用程序开发过程。Windows通用平台提供了一套共享的API和工具,使开发者能够在不同设备上构建统一的用户体验。Win10 Ap

p开发的过程包括安装开发工具、创建项目、设计用户界面、编写代码、测试和发布等步骤。

vue项目打包exe文件工具推荐

Vue是一个流行的JavaScript框架,用于构建单页应用程序。Vue的应用程序可以打包成可执行文件,这样用户就可以在没有安装Vue的情况下运行应用程序。本文将介绍如何将Vue项目打包成可执行文件。

打包Vue项目的工具

Vue CLI是一个命令行工具,用于创建和管理Vue项目。Vue CLI提供了打包Vue项目的功能。Vue CLI使用WebPack打包器,将Vue应用程序的代码转换为JavaScript、CSS和HTML文件,然后将这些文件打包到一个文件中。

安装Vue CLI

首先,需要安装Vue CLI。可以使用npm安装Vue CLI。在命令行中输入以下命令:

“`

npm install -g @vue/cli

“`

创建Vue项目

使用Vue CLI创建一个新的Vue项目。在命令行中输入以下命令:

“`

vue create my-vue-app

“`

这将创建一个名为my-vue-app的新Vue项目。Vue CLI将提示您选择要使用的特性。按回车键选择默认值即可。

打包Vue项目

在Vue项目的根目录中,运行以下命令:

“`

npm run build

“`

这将使用WebPack打包器打包Vue应用程序的代码,并将它们放入dist目录中。dist目录包含了一个名为index.html的文件,该文件包含了Vue应用程序的入口点。

测试Vue应用程序

现在,您可以测试Vue应用程序是否正确打包。在dist目录中,运行以下命令:

“`

npm install -g http-server

http-server

“`

这将启动一个Web服务器,并将dist目录作为根目录。在浏览器中打开http://localhost:8080,您应该能够看到Vue应用程序的运行结果。

打包可执行文件

使用Electron打包器可以将Vue应用程序打包成可执行文件。Electron是一个基于Node.js和Chromium的框架,用于构建桌面应用程序。Electron将Vue应用程序包装在一个桌面应用程序中,并提供与操作系统的交互功能,例如菜单、对话框和通知。

安装Electron

首先,需要安装Electron。在命令行中输入以下命令:

“`

npm install electron –save-dev

“`

创建Electron应用程序

在Vue项目的根目录中,创建一个名为main.js的新文件。将以下代码粘贴到main.js文件中:

“`

const { app, BrowserWindow } = require(‘electron’)

function createWindow () {

// 创建浏览器窗口

let win = new BrowserWindow({

width: 800,

height: 600,

webPreferences: {

nodeIntegration: true

}

})

// 加载Vue应用程序

win.loadFile(‘dist/index.html’)

}

// 当Electron准备好创建浏览器窗口时调用createWindow函数

app.whenReady().then(createWindow)

“`

这将创建一个Electron应用程序,该应用程序将加载Vue应用程序的程序打包工具editdist/index.html文件。

打包Electron应用程序

在Vue项目的根目录中,创建一个名为package.json的新文件。将以下代码粘贴到package.json文件中:

“`

{

“name”: “my-electron-app”,

“version”: “1.0.0”,

“main”: “main.js”,

“scripts”: {

“start”: “electron .”

程序反向打包},

“dependencies”: {

“electron”: “^10.1.5”

},

“devDependencies”: {},

“author”: “”,

“license”: “ISC”

}

“`

这将创建一个Electron应用程序的描述文件,该文件包含了应用程序的名称、版本、入口点和依赖项。

运行以下命令:

“`

npm run start

“`

这将启动Electron应用程序,并加载Vue应用程序

。现在,可以将整个应用程序打包成一个可执行文件。在命令行中输入以下命令:

“`

npm install electron-packager –save-dev

“`

这将安装electron-packager,一个用于打包Electron应用程序的工具。运行以下命令:

“`

electron-packager . my-electron-app –platform=win32 –arch=x64 –icon=icon.ico –overwrite

“`

这将使用electron-packager将Electron应用程序打包成一个可执行文件。可执行文件将被放置在my-electron-app-win32-x64目录中。

总结

本文介绍了如何将Vue项目打包成可执行文件。首先,使用Vue CLI将Vue应用程序打包成JavaScript、CSS和HTML文件。然后,使用Electron将Vue应用程序包装在一个桌面应用程序中,并提供与操作系统的交互功能。最后,使用electron-packager将整个应用程序打包成一个可执行文件。

ad软件89s51封装是什么意思?

89S51是一种单片机,可以实现控制电路的功能。在实际应用中,我们需要将89S51单片机与其他电子元器件相互连接,以实现各种功能。这就需要用到封装技术,将89S51单片机进行封装,使其更加方便使用和连接。

封装技术是指将电子元器件封装在外壳中,以保护电子元器件,方便使用和连接。封装技术可以分为表面贴装和插装两种。表面贴装是将电子元器件直接贴在印刷电路板表面,而插装则是将电子元器件插在插座中,然后再将插座插入印刷电路板中。

在89S

51单片机封装中,常用的是插装技术。89S51单片机的封装形式有DIP、PLCC、QFP等多种。其中,DIP封装是最为常见的一种封装形式。DIP封装的89S51单片机有40个引脚,可以直接插在印刷电路板上。DIP封装的89S51单片应用做机具有连接方便、价格低廉等优点。

除了DIP封装外,PLCC封装和QFP封装也是常用的封装形式。PLCC封装和DIP封装相似,但是其引脚是以两排排列的。QFP封装则是将引脚变成了一排排列的,且引脚数量更多,可以实现更多的功能。但是,PLCC封装和QFP封装的价格相对较高桌面搭建软件,不适合一些简单的应用。

在进行89S51单片机封装时,需要注意以下几点:

1. 确定封装形式:根据实际需要选择合适的封装形式,以实现所需的功能。

2. 确定引脚数量:根据实际需要确定所需的引脚数量,以保证电子元器件能够正常连接。

3. 确定引脚排列方式:根据实际需要选择合适的引脚排列方式,以方便连接。

4. 确定封装材料:根据实际需要选择合适的封装材料,以保护电子元器件。

总之,89S51单片机封装是将其与其他电子元器件相互连接的必要步骤,也是保护电子元器件的重要手段。在进行89S51单片机封装时,需要根据实际需要选择合适的封装形式、引脚数量、引脚排列方式和封装材料,以实现所需的功能。

vue项目打包exe文件要怎么做?

Vue是一个流行的JavaScript框架,用于构建单页应用程序。Vue的应用程序可以打包成可执行文件,这样用户就可以在没有安装Vue的情况下运行应用程序。本文将介绍如何将Vue项目打包成可执行文件。

打包Vue项目的工具

Vue CLI是一个命令行工具,用于创建和管理Vue项目。Vue CLI提供了打包Vue项目的功能。Vue CLI使用WebPack打包器,将Vue应用程序的代码转换为JavaScript、CSS和HTML文件,然后将这些文件打包到一个文件中。

安装Vue CLI

首先,需要安装Vue CLI。可以使用npm安装Vue CLI。在命令行中输入以下命令:

“`

npm install -g @vue/cli

“`

创建Vue项目

使用Vue CLI创建一个新的Vue项目。在命令行中输入以下命令:

“`

vue create my-vue-app

“`

这将创建一个名为my-vue-app的新Vue项目。Vue CLI将提示您选择要使用的特性。按回车键选择默认值即可。

打包Vue项目

在Vue项目的根目录中,运行以下命令:

“`

npm run build

“`

这将使用WebPack打包器打包Vue应用程序的代码,并将它们放入dist目录中。dist目录包含了一个名为index.html的文件,该文件包含了Vue应用程序的入口点。

测试Vue应用程序

现在,您可以测试Vue应用程序是否正确打包。在dist目录中,运行以下命令:

“`

npm install -g http-server

http-server

“`

这将启动一个Web服务器,并将dist目录作为根目录。在浏览器中打开http://localhost:8080,您应该能够看到Vue应用程序的运行结果。

打包可执行文件

使用Electron打包器可以将Vue应用程序打包成可执行文件。Electron是一个基于Node.js和Chromium的框架,用于构建桌面应用程序。Electron将Vue应用程序包装在一个桌面应用程序中,并提供与操作系统的交互功能,例如菜单、对话框和通知。

安装Electron

首先,需要安装Electron。在命令行中输入以下命令:

“`

npm install electron –save-dev

“`

创建Electron应用程序

在Vue项目的根目录中,创建一个名为main.js的新文件。将以下代码粘贴到main.js文件中:

“`

const { app, BrowserWindow } = require(‘electron’)

function createWindow () {

// 创建浏览器窗口

let win = new BrowserWindow({

width: 800,

height: 600,

webPreferences: {

nodeIntegration: true

}

})

// 加载Vue应用程序

win.loadFile(‘dist/index.html’)

}

// 当Electron准备好创建浏览器窗口时调用createWindow函数

app.whenReady().then(createWindow)

“`

这将创建一个Electron应用程序,该应用程序将加载Vue应用程序的程序打包工具editdist/index.html文件。

打包Electron应用程序

在Vue项目的根目录中,创建一个名为package.json的新文件。将以下代码粘贴到package.json文件中:

“`

{

“name”: “my-electron-app”,

“version”: “1.0.0”,

“main”: “main.js”,

“scripts”: {

“start”: “electron .”

程序反向打包},

“dependencies”: {

“electron”: “^10.1.5”

},

“devDependencies”: {},

“author”: “”,

“license”: “ISC”

}

“`

这将创建一个Electron应用程序的描述文件,该文件包含了应用程序的名称、版本、入口点和依赖项。

运行以下命令:

“`

npm run start

“`

这将启动Electron应用程序,并加载Vue应用程序

。现在,可以将整个应用程序打包成一个可执行文件。在命令行中输入以下命令:

“`

npm install electron-packager –save-dev

“`

这将安装electron-packager,一个用于打包Electron应用程序的工具。运行以下命令:

“`

electron-packager . my-electron-app –platform=win32 –arch=x64 –icon=icon.ico –overwrite

“`

这将使用electron-packager将Electron应用程序打包成一个可执行文件。可执行文件将被放置在my-electron-app-win32-x64目录中。

总结

本文介绍了如何将Vue项目打包成可执行文件。首先,使用Vue CLI将Vue应用程序打包成JavaScript、CSS和HTML文件。然后,使用Electron将Vue应用程序包装在一个桌面应用程序中,并提供与操作系统的交互功能。最后,使用electron-packager将整个应用程序打包成一个可执行文件。